Do hinges go inside or outside?
Most exterior doors open toward the inside of the house. That means the hinges, which hold the door in place, are located inside the house.
Do you attach hinges or door first?
Place your new door into the frame, and use wedges to hold it in position. Now, take your screwdriver and screw the hinges into the hinge rebates of the frame. It’s always easier to attach the top hinge first.
Do hinges have to be flush?
Surface-mounted hinges are designed for installation directly onto the door and the door frame. Recessed hinges will require you to cut into the wood so that the hinge will sit flush. Where should door hinges be placed?
Because gravity works on a door in this way, hinges are placed on the high side, with the bottom hinge 10 inches from the bottom of the door and the top one 5 inches from the top of the door. You can get away with two hinges on a light, hollow-core door, but will need at least three on solid core or exterior doors.

Do you have to notch door for hinges?
When you install a door hinge, you need to make notches for it on the edge of the door and on the jamb, or the door won’t close properly. These notches, or mortises, should be just deep enough to allow the surface of the hinge to sit flush with the wood.

How do you install door hinges?
Installing Door Hinges Place your hinges in the correct location. Trace around the hinge. Cut the mortise. Mark the location of the screws. Drill the pilot holes. Install the individual hinges. Connect the door to the jamb.
